Jira Dashboard Widget, how to use Relative date variables

I'm looking to create a dashboard that would display the test executions for the last week.

I was hoping to make use of the https://support.atlassian.com/analytics/docs/relative-date-variables/ but it appears that the Zephyr scale gadgets are not compatible with this syntax.

 

Is there a way to input relative dates into the date filters for dashboard gadgets?

 

Thanks

  • Unfortunately this is a gap in the reporting and dashboard features - we can't currently use variables for things like today, start of week, etc..  I've worked around this problem in the past by changing the URL (which contains all report logic and therefore he date parameter) but I am considering using bookmarklets with some scripting as a more elegant solution while we wait for SmartBear to implement this feature.
